Religious law is explicitly based upon religious precepts. Examples include the Jewish Halakha and Islamic Sharia—equally of which translate as being the "route to follow". Christian canon legislation also survives in some church communities. Usually the implication of religion for regulation is unalterability, because the word of God can't be amended or legislated versus by judges or governments.[96] However, most spiritual jurisdictions depend upon even further human elaboration to supply for comprehensive and detailed legal techniques.

Labour legislation is the review of a tripartite industrial marriage among worker, employer and trade union. This includes collective bargaining regulation, and also the right to strike. Unique employment regulation refers to place of work rights, such as career safety, health and fitness and protection or possibly a minimum wage.

Precedent plus the doctrine of stare decisis Perform a substantive job in legal final decision-building by guaranteeing consistency and steadiness in the law. Precedent refers to preceding court selections which guideline long term cases with related info or legal issues. Stare decisis, this means “to stand by issues made the decision,” could be the basic principle that courts ought to adhere to these precedents.
